Four polarizer’s are placed in succession with their axes vertical, at 30o to the vertical, at 60o to the vertical, and at 90o to the vertical.
(a) Calculate what fraction of the incident Unpolarized light is transmitted by the four polarizer’s.
(b) Can the transmitted light be decreased by removing one of the polarizer’s?
If so, which one?
(c) Can the transmitted light intensity be extinguished by removing polarizer’s? If so, which one(s)?
